Issue Overview
I have a gravity form with an image file upload. I have created a feed from the gravity form to a pod. All the text fields in the gravity form are mapped to the pods fields and there is no issue. The image file upload from the gravity form is uploaded to the Media Library but the image is not in the pod image field. I need to do the file upload for the pod entry.
Is there a solution for this as I have many file upload for images in the gravity form to a pod? It will be very tedious to do it one by one for the pod entries.
I sent a support ticket to Gravity Forms and their response was:
Gravity Forms doesn't provide any built-in integration or support for Pods, this may cause Pods do not recognize the data saved for certain field types where Gravity Forms and Pods do not use the same format to store the data.
The Gravity Forms support suggested that I reach out to Pods Support.
